Airflow obstruction and reduced lung function increase the risk of heart failure
A large population-based study has found that lung function and obstructive airway diseases are strongly and independently associated with increased risk of heart failure.
European Neandertals were on the verge of extinction even before the arrival of modern humans
New findings from an international team of researchers show that most Neandertals in Europe died off around 50,000 years ago.
